Another Arrest in KCR Family

The BRS ecosystem is rattling in the Congress regime with relentless legal action against those who are facing anti-social allegations. Recently, KCR’s daughter, Kavitha was arrested in the Delhi liquor policy case and now, it is the turn of KCR’s nephew, a Hyderabad-based businessman, Kalvakuntla Thejeshwar Rao alias Kanna Rao to come under the legal jurisdiction.

Kanna Rao is one of the 38 accused in an attempt to murder and land grab case filed by Bandoju Srinivas, the director of OSR Projects. Kanna Rao is accused of trying to forcibly grab 2 acres of land in Adibatla which was originally intended to be developed by OSR projects. He is facing charges of attempting to murder, criminal trespass, causing damage, and using explosive substances.

Adibatla police have now arrested Kanna Rao who is the main accused in the case and he will be remanded shortly. This comes after the Telangana High Court rejected the anticipatory bail petitions filed by Kanna Rao twice in the last two weeks.
